The Pitt": Real-Time Medical Drama Redefines Genre

The Pitt," an HBO Max medical drama premiering in 2025, realistically portrays a 15-hour ER shift in real-time across its first season, using a large ensemble cast and focusing on both major emergencies and mundane patient interactions to create a unique, engaging narrative.

AI Voice Enhancement in Oscar-Nominated Films Sparks Hollywood Controversy

Sound editors on the Oscar-contending films "The Brutalist" and "Emilia Perez" admitted to using AI to alter actors' voices, sparking controversy within the Hollywood film industry, and contradicting agreements made after a recent industry-wide strike.

Deezer combats AI-generated music to fairly compensate artists

Deezer announced that 10% of its uploaded tracks are AI-generated, prompting the development of an internal detection tool to identify and remove approximately 10,000 daily AI-created tracks to better compensate artists, contrasting with Spotify's use of AI-generated "Perfect Fit Content.

Max Ophüls Preis Awards €130,000, Launches New Treatment Development Award

The 46th Max Ophüls Preis film festival in Saarbrücken, Germany, will award €130,000 in prizes on January 28th, including a new €10,000 award for treatment development, showcasing 151 films from Germany, Austria, and Switzerland across nine venues.

Netflix Reports Record Subscriber Growth, Announces Price Hike

Netflix reported a record 19 million new subscribers in Q4 2024, reaching 302 million globally, driven by live sports and popular shows; however, the company also announced across-the-board price increases in the U.S., ranging from $1 to $2.50 per subscription tier.
